Well-known signing
Ferencváros signed the 25-year old, MLS and Norwegian champion Henry Wingo from Molde.

The 31-time Hungarian Champion Ferencváros signed today the Norwegian Champion, FK Molde’s right back, Henry Wingo. The 25-year old American right back and winger played last against our team in the Champions League play-off match in September.
 
Introduction
Henry Wingo was born October 4th, 1995 in Seattle, Washington. He started playing at the local Seattle Sounders FC and signed later his first professional agreement. After two years in the youth teams of Seattle, in 2014 he transferred to Washington Huskies. Half a season later Washington loaned him out to PSA Elite but three months later he returned to Washington once again.
 
Sounders FC used him in both the first and second team and also sent him on loan to further teams. He was part of the Champion team of MLS with Seattle. Then, in 2019 august, he signed overseas, to Molde. In his first Norwegian season they won the league and the right to participate in the Champions League qualifiers.
 
Molde played successfully up until the playoffs, where they met our side: the American defender was on the pitch during the entire first leg (ending with 3-3), later, after Ferencváros proceeded to the group stage, participated in the Europa League with Molde. Out of the 6 appearances in EL, Wingo played throughout 4 matches: twice against Arsenal and also against Dundalk and Rapid Wien. Molde collected 10 points and qualified for the next rounds in the Europa League.
 
He was a regular at Molde even during season 2020: he played 20 times, scored twice and had one assist. Molde finished second in the league. He scored his first professional goal in Norway against Viking on July 15th, 2020.

 
On September 19, 2020, he scored his second goal against Valerenga.

 

Biography

Name: Henry Wingo
Date and Place of Birth: 1995. October  4., Seattle, Washington (US)
Former clubs: Washington (2014-2015), PSA Elite (2015 – on loan), Washington (2015-2017), Sounders FC (2017-19), Sounders FC II (2017 – on loan), Tacoma Defiance (2018-2019 – on loan), Molde (2019-2021)
Successes: Norwegian champion (2019), norvég ezüstérmes (2020), MLS-champion (2019)
